TUNNEY SUED AGAIN
ALIENATING WIFE’S AFFECTIONS. Gene Tunncy, the former heavyweight boxing champion of the world, is learned that the life of Ihc millionaire ex-champion is not altogether a bed of roses. Facing a bread! of promise suit for £IOO,OOO brought by Mrs Katherine Fogarty, ho is now defendant in another action for the same amount tiled by her husband, Mr John S. Fogarty, for alienation of his wife’s affections.
In his complaint Mr Fogarty alleges that atMrTunney’s request his wife sought to divorce him and that the ex-champion promised to marry her. The husband also alleges that his wife, “ at divers times,” appeared as Mr Tunney’s wife in four American cities. Papers in the suit and in the attachment of Mr Tunney’s property near Stamford, Connecticut, have been filed at Standford. This property is already under attachment in the suit brought by Mrs Fogarty. Gene Tunney was married in Rome last October to. Miss Josephine Lauder, an American heiress.
